Yin , that character picture is mostly great but I feel theres some areas you would need to look at again...

i - his arm closest to the viewer , the muscles seem wrong. I dont see how it connects to the elbow and lower part of the arm.

ii - the hand holding the sword seems off as well, the shading/shadow suggests to me the hand is turned at a 45 degree angle, but the sword is at more of a 30 degree angle. The angle the hand is suggesting and the sword is at are different.

iii - the pose is rather bland , put some roses in the hand and it would work equally well... I would suggest changing it so he is pointing the sword at a imaginary foe in front of him, and changing the free arm to open handed.

Bare in mind it is just an opinion, and the actual artwork is good I just felt the above mentioned points needed addressing.

Paint can gets the job done, albeit slowly and somewhat, uhm... unintuitively, let's say? Other programs have benefits like improved UIs, more tools, hotkeys, palette options, what-have-you. Good stuff that, while not essential, undeniably speeds up and facilitates the whole process.

Also, 3 undos is just not enough.  Tongue
